Skip to content
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 0 additions & 2 deletions .gitattributes

This file was deleted.

41 changes: 22 additions & 19 deletions .gitignore
Original file line number Diff line number Diff line change
@@ -1,23 +1,26 @@
# eclipse
bin
*.launch
.settings
.metadata
.classpath
.project
# Gradle files
.gradle/
build/
out/
bin/

# idea
out
*.ipr
*.iws
# IDE files
.idea/
*.iml
.idea
.vscode/
.settings/
.classpath
.project
*.launch

# gradle
build
.gradle
# Mod Dev files
run/
logs/
crash-reports/
debug.log
debug.log.gz
latest.log

# other
eclipse
run
libs
# OS files
.DS_Store
Thumbs.db
21 changes: 0 additions & 21 deletions LICENSE

This file was deleted.

84 changes: 84 additions & 0 deletions build.gradle
Original file line number Diff line number Diff line change
@@ -0,0 +1,84 @@
plugins {
id 'java-library'
id 'net.neoforged.moddev' version '2.0.120'
}

version = project.mod_version
group = project.mod_group_id

repositories {
mavenLocal()
maven {
url = "https://maven.neoforged.net/releases/"
}
maven {
url = "https://www.cursemaven.com"
}
// Local libs
flatDir {
dirs 'libs'
}
}

base {
archivesName = project.mod_id
}



java.toolchain.languageVersion = JavaLanguageVersion.of(21)

sourceSets {
main {
resources {
srcDir 'src/generated/resources'
}
}
}





neoForge {
version = project.neoforge_version

mods {
"${mod_id}" {
sourceSet(sourceSets.main)
}
}

runs {
configureEach {
systemProperty 'forge.logging.markers', 'REGISTRIES'
systemProperty 'forge.logging.console.level', 'debug'
}

client {
client()
}

server {
server()
}
}
}

dependencies {
// NeoForge provided by plugin

// Quark (Local)
implementation files("../Quark-master/build/libs/Quark-4.1-472-SNAPSHOT.jar")
implementation files("../Quark-master/localjars/Zeta-1.1-36L.jar")

// Dynamic Trees (CurseMaven)
implementation "curse.maven:dynamictrees-252818:7259604"

// Dynamic Trees Plus (CurseMaven)
implementation "curse.maven:dynamictreesplus-478155:7513822"
}

tasks.withType(JavaCompile).configureEach {
options.encoding = 'UTF-8'
}
186 changes: 0 additions & 186 deletions build.gradle.kts

This file was deleted.

16 changes: 0 additions & 16 deletions buildSrc/build.gradle.kts

This file was deleted.

35 changes: 15 additions & 20 deletions gradle.properties
Original file line number Diff line number Diff line change
@@ -1,20 +1,15 @@
modName=DynamicTreesQuark
modVersion=2.1.3
group=com.maxhyper.dtquark

mcVersion=1.16.5
forgeVersion=36.2.34

dynamicTreesVersion=0.10.0-Beta34
arlVersion=1.6-49.90
quarkVersion=r2.4-322.1
hwylaVersion=1.10.11-B78_1.16.2
jeiVersion=7.7.1.139
patchouliVersion=1.16.4-53.2
ccVersion=1.100.9
suggestionProviderFixVersion=1.0.0

curseFileType=release

org.gradle.jvmargs=-Xmx3G
org.gradle.daemon=false
mod_id=dtquark
mod_name=Dynamic Trees for Quark
mod_license=MIT
mod_version=2.5.4
mod_group_id=org.violetmoon.dtquark
mod_authors=Vazkii, ThePixelCoder
mod_description=Dynamic Trees compatibility for Quark

minecraft_version=1.21.1
neoforge_version=21.1.195
neoforge_loader_version_range=[4,)
minecraft_version_range=[1.21.1]

quark_version=4.1-472-SNAPSHOT
dynamictrees_version=1.6.0
Binary file added gradle/wrapper/gradle-wrapper.jar
Binary file not shown.
Loading